Walsenburg
Walsenburg has notably lower household income than the US average, with a median household income of $22,005. Population has grown 27% since 1990. 10%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, below the national rate of 24%. Median home value has more than doubled since 1990, reaching $62,100. The poverty rate of 20.6% is well above the national figure. Households here earn about 53% less than the Colorado median.

How many people live in Walsenburg, Colorado?
Walsenburg, Colorado has about 4,182 residents according to the 2000 Census.
What is the median household income in Walsenburg, Colorado?
The typical household in Walsenburg, Colorado earns about $22,005 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.
Is Walsenburg, Colorado expensive?
In Walsenburg, Colorado, the median home is worth about $62,100, and the typical rent is about $393 a month.
How educated are people in Walsenburg, Colorado?
About 9.7% of adults age 25 and over in Walsenburg, Colorado h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
What is the poverty rate in Walsenburg, Colorado?
About 20.6% of people in Walsenburg, Colorado live below the federal poverty line.
Has Walsenburg, Colorado grown since 1990?
Yes, Walsenburg, Colorado has grown since 1990. The population has added about 882 residents, a change of about 27 percent over that period.
